Solar energy
Across
- 2. Other word for nonrenewable
- 4. The ability to be maintained at a certain rate or level
- 6. Energy stocked by the body
- 7. Particule creating electricity in the solar panel
Down
- 1. Effect discovered by Becquerel
- 3. First use of solar energy
- 5. Solar panels use sunlight to generate this